This book by Imam Muhammad ibn Ahmad al-Buhuti al-Khalwati (d. 1088 AH) is a detailed commentary on the book "Al-Iqna' fi Fiqh al-Imam Ahmad" by Imam Musa al-Hajjawi (d. 968 AH). It addresses the rulings of worship, transactions, and personal status matters with scholarly precision. It is distinguished by its clear and systematic style, which makes it an essential reference for students of the Hanbali school who wish to master its Fiqh methodology, and by its accuracy in clarifying the positions of Imam Ahmad, as later developments in the Hanbali school sometimes deviated from his original statements.
Al-Buhuti's commentary is highly valued in Hanbali circles for its strict adherence to textual evidence and deep analysis of Fiqh principles. Often studied alongside al-Iqna‘, it bridges classical scholarship with modern learning. Its structured format helps students grasp the complexities of Hanbali jurisprudence. Supplementing it with contemporary Hanbali explanations can make it even more accessible.
The Dar al-Raka’iz edition stands out for its rigorous verification, using three manuscripts to ensure textual accuracy, and includes helpful footnotes that clarify complex points and add context. This careful editorial work makes it a trusted resource for students and researchers of Hanbali Fiqh.
